Dambudzo Marechera

1952 – 1987

The House of Hunger, and the Guardian Fiction Prize

Why they are here

His first book won the Guardian Fiction Prize in 1979 and broke every convention of African writing at the time. He was dead at thirty-five and has never stopped being read.

Dambudzo Marechera won critical acclaim for The House of Hunger, a collection of stories giving a fierce account of life in Rhodesia under white rule.

Published in 1978, it won the Guardian Fiction Prize the following year.
